当前位置:首页 > 建站教程 > 正文

Tomcat搭建网站,轻松入门,开启你的Web开发之旅

Tomcat搭建网站,轻松入门,开启你的Web开发之旅

随着互联网的飞速发展,Web开发已经成为当今社会最热门的技术领域之一,作为Java技术栈中不可或缺的一部分,Tomcat成为了许多开发者的首选Web服务器,本文将为您详...

随着互联网的飞速发展,Web开发已经成为当今社会最热门的技术领域之一,作为Java技术栈中不可或缺的一部分,Tomcat成为了许多开发者的首选Web服务器,本文将为您详细介绍如何使用Tomcat搭建网站,帮助您轻松入门Web开发。

Tomcat简介

Tomcat是一个开源的Java Servlet容器,由Apache软件基金会维护,它实现了Java Servlet和JavaServer Pages(JSP)技术规范,是构建Java Web应用程序的基础,Tomcat具有以下特点

1、免费开源:Tomcat是免费的,可以免费下载和使用。

2、功能丰富:Tomcat支持Java Servlet、JSP、WebSocket等技术,满足各种Web应用需求。

3、轻量级:Tomcat体积小巧,运行稳定,适用于各种服务器环境。

4、社区活跃:Tomcat拥有庞大的开发者社区,提供丰富的技术支持和资源。

搭建Tomcat环境

1、下载Tomcat

访问Apache官网(https://tomcat.apache.org/),下载适合您操作系统的Tomcat版本,Tomcat最新版本为10.0.0-M5。

2、安装Tomcat

(1)解压下载的Tomcat压缩包到指定目录。

(2)配置环境变量

在Windows系统中,右键点击“此电脑”选择“属性”,点击“高级系统设置”,在“系统属性”窗口中,点击“环境变量”按钮,在“系统变量”中,点击“新建”,输入变量名“CATALINA_HOME”,变量值设置为Tomcat的安装路径,在“系统变量”中,点击“新建”,输入变量名“PATH”,变量值添加“%CATALINA_HOME%in”。

在Linux系统中,打开终端,输入以下命令:

export CATALINA_HOME=/path/to/tomcat
export PATH=$PATH:$CATALINA_HOME/bin

(3)启动Tomcat

在Windows系统中,双击Tomcat安装目录下的“startup.bat”文件。

在Linux系统中,打开终端,输入以下命令:

./bin/startup.sh

启动成功后,在浏览器中输入“http://localhost:8080/”,即可看到Tomcat欢迎页面。

搭建网站

1、创建项目

(1)在Tomcat安装目录下的“webapps”文件夹中创建一个新文件夹,myproject”。

(2)在“myproject”文件夹中创建以下目录:

- WEB-INF

- classes

- lib

- resources

- src

(3)在“WEB-INF”目录下创建一个名为“web.xml”的文件,内容如下:

<web-app xmlns="http://xmlns.jcp.org/xml/ns/javaee"
         x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
         xsi:schemaLocation="http://xmlns.jcp.org/xml/ns/javaee
         http://xmlns.jcp.org/xml/ns/javaee/web-app_3_1.xsd"
         version="3.1">
</web-app>

2、编写Java代码

在“src”目录下创建一个名为“HelloWorld.java”的文件,内容如下:

package com.example;
import javax.servlet.*;
import javax.servlet.http.*;
import java.io.*;
public class HelloWorld extends HttpServlet {
    @Override
    protected void doGet(HttpServletRequest request, HttpServletResponse response)
            throws ServletException, IOException {
        response.setContentType("text/html;charset=UTF-8");
        PrintWriter out = response.getWriter();
        out.println("<h1>Hello, World!</h1>");
    }
}

3、编写JSP页面

在“WEB-INF”目录下创建一个名为“index.jsp”的文件,内容如下:

<%@ page contentType="text/html;charset=UTF-8" language="java" %>
<html>
<head>
    <title>Hello World</title>
</head>
<body>
    <h1>Hello, World!</h1>
</body>
</html>

4、部署项目

在浏览器中输入“http://localhost:8080/myproject/”,即可看到Hello World页面。

本文介绍了如何使用Tomcat搭建网站,包括下载、安装、配置环境变量、创建项目、编写Java代码和JSP页面等步骤,通过本文的学习,相信您已经掌握了Tomcat搭建网站的基本技能,您可以继续深入学习Java Web开发,开启您的Web开发之旅。

    最新文章